Walter Franklin Williams
(5 November 1889 - 5 November 1958)
Hamburg Reporter
Thursday, December 11, 1958
page 6, Columns 6-7

Walter Franklin Williams, son of Andrew and Susan Alice Williams, was born Nov 5, 1889, at Limestone, Tenn., and died at Hamburg Community Hospital, Nov 5, 1958, at the age of 69 years, after a long illness.

Walt had lived in Fremont county for the past 45 years and spent many years as a car salesman.  On Sept 18, 1948, he was united in marriage to Hazel Maupin at Hiawatha, Kans. Mr. Williams was a member of the Presbyterian church of Hamburg and Hubert Woodward Post of the American Legion.  He was associated with the Hamburg Clothing Co. for the last few years.

He is survived by his wife, Hazel, of Hamburg, three daughters, Mrs. Lucille Martindale and Mrs. Leona Gregg, both of Glenwood, Iowa and Mrs. Wilma Fuchs of Canoga Park, Calif., eleven grandchildren, five great grandchildren three brothers and three sisters, all of Tennessee.

Services were held Saturday, Nov 8, at 10 am at the Rash Funeral Home with the Rev. Jim Nealeigh officiating.  Interment in the Hamburg Cemetery.

Walter Williams (5 November 1889 - 5 November 1958)

The Hamburg Reporter
November 13, 1958, page 1

Walter Williams resident 45 years Services for Walter Franklin Williams, Hamburg businessman for 45 years, were held at the Rash Funeral Home Saturday, November 8, at 10 am.  The Rev Jin Nealeigh officiated.     Mr. Williams had been in poor health for several years, but had been active until a few months ago.  A widely known car salesman for many years, he had been associated with Hamburg Clothing the last few years.     A native of Limestone, Tenn., he died on his 69th birthday, Nov 5.  He was a veteran of World War II.

Survivors include his wife, Hazel of Hamburg and three children by a former marriage:  Mrs. Lucille Martindale and Mrs. Leona Gregg of Glenwood, and Mrs. William Fuchs of Canoga Park, Calif., eleven grandchildren, five great grandchildren and three brothers and three sisters in Tennessee.     Interment was in the Hamburg cemetery.

Also on the same page, column 1,  November 13, 1958:
Country Tub Thumping by John Field "The true mark of a man is sometimes evident at his funeral.  Such was the case with Walt Williams.  A cross section of Hamburg was present to pay respect to quite a remarkable person. He knew almost everyone, was liked and respected by almost everyone.  Those who hunted with Walt, or fished with him, or were fortunate enough  to do business with him, will be hard pressed to find his equal. Hamburg has lost its best gardener, and one of its most staunch supporters."
